使用phpexcel來呼叫RATE公式,如下
$objPHPExcel->getActiveSheet()->
setCellValue('A1', '=RATE(360,-8000,0,8263463,0,0.1) * 12');
echo $objPHPExcel->getActiveSheet()->getCell('A1')->getCalculatedValue(true);
得到2.0268253631406E-13
但把該xls存檔後用excel開啟,A1的值為0.061455074(此為正確的值)
為什麼用getCalculatedValue取到的值會不同?